About this role
Maintenance Technician, Reliability Maintenance Engineering Ravenhall, Victoria, AUS Amazon is seeking Maintenance Technicians to join our growing Reliability, Maintenance & Engineering (RME) team, servicing our sites in both Mulgrave and Ravenhall in Victoria. As a Maintenance Technician, you'll keep our sites' operating safely and efficiently by maintaining and repairing material handling equipment, automated packaging, and distribution machinery. You'll respond to breakdowns, perform preventative maintenance, and implement long-term improvements to reduce downtime. This is a Rotating Roster position working primarily 4 days x 10 hour shifts but flexibility will be required at times to support shift gaps when other team members are on PTO or training. This role will be entitled to annual leave and penalty rates where applicable and be critical to keep 24/7 operations running. Learn more about Amazon RME in Australia Key job responsibilities - Carry out planned preventative maintenance on the full range of equipment within the site. - Put health & safety best practices first in all work carried out. - React quickly to breakdowns, communicate clearly with affected teams and work efficiently to fix the issue. - Support continuous improvement by learning from breakdowns and sending feedback and suggestions for improvements through the line manager. - Provide high levels of equipment availability to our internal customers. - Support and learn from Senior Maintenance Technicians.
